A public meeting is being held later this month about the ongoing assessment of Earystane and Scard as a potential windfarm location.
Held by Arbory and Rushen Commissioners, the meeting is a chance to hear why that site is the preferred location and will include a question and answer session.
The panel will include the Chief Minister, Chairman of Manx Utilities and senior officers and consultants.
It's taking place on Wednesday November 29 at 7pm at Rushen Primary School.
